为寻求安全系统学研究的切入点并完善安全系统学,从安全系统的相似特性出发,提出相似安全系统学定义和内涵,从安全学科的属性及系统特征论证了创建相似安全系统学的可行性及其意义;阐述了相似安全系统学的学科基础,构建了相似安全系统学的概念体系、研究层次及应用领域;从多个视角层面对相似安全系统学的学科分支进行分类,指出比较安全方法可作为相似安全系统学的主要研究工具,并展望了相似安全系统学的发展方向及延伸的相关学科.研究表明,相似安全系统学将为安全系统学研究提供新的思路和方法.
Abstract
To seek breakthrough point of safety systematics and to improve it, definition and contents about similarity safety systematics were put forward according similar characteristics of safety system. The feasibility and significance of establishing similarity safety systematics were argued through subject attribute and system feature. Subject foundations of similarity safety systematics were described, the concept system, research levels and application fields were constructed. Then, the discipline branches were classified within multi-view, and took comparative safety method as the main research tool of similarity safety systematics. Development direction and related subjects extended from similarity safety systematics were prospected at last. Research shows that, similarity safety systematics provides new thoughts and methods to the research of safety systematics.
